Since I’m not really a scarf wearer I decided to do a manicure inspired by the scarf and I have to say, I love the way it turned out!
For the base I used essie Blossom Dandy. Then I used a medium sized dotting tool and added polka dots using JulieG Liquid Metal. The result was surprisingly similar to the scarf. And honestly, I loved this manicure so much I had a hard time not starring at it.
